How changes propagate between AWS Aurora PostgreSQL and Magento

Each direction of the sync is driven by what the source system can signal and what the destination accepts — detection, delivery, and expected latency below.

AWS Aurora PostgreSQL Magento Sub-second propagation

DetectionChanges in AWS Aurora PostgreSQL are captured at the source via change data capture — no polling loop against its API. Log-based CDC via PostgreSQL logical replication (WAL decoding through replication slots), with timestamp polling as a fallback.

DeliveryEach detected change is written to Magento through its API, with automatic retries and rate-limit backoff.

Magento AWS Aurora PostgreSQL Sub-second propagation

DetectionMagento notifies Stacksync of record changes through webhook events. Polling with searchCriteria filters on updated_at (catalog, sales, and customer entities carry created_at/updated_at).

DeliveryEach detected change is applied to AWS Aurora PostgreSQL as a row-level write, with types converted between the two schemas.

Rate-limit considerations

  • Magento: No fixed request-per-minute cap on PaaS/on-prem; responses page via searchCriteria pageSize/currentPage under a default maximum page size of 300 (Web API Input Limits), with /async/bulk endpoints for large writes.

How the AWS Aurora PostgreSQL and Magento connectors work

AWS Aurora PostgreSQL

Integration surface
SQL wire protocol (PostgreSQL-compatible), standard Postgres drivers and JDBC
Authentication
Database credentials, optionally AWS IAM database authentication, over TLS
Change detection
Log-based CDC via PostgreSQL logical replication (WAL decoding through replication slots), with timestamp polling as a fallback
Capabilities
read · write · CDC

Magento

Integration surface
REST and GraphQL Web APIs (SOAP also available)
Authentication
Token-based OAuth: an integration's access token (consumer key/secret + access token/secret) or a Bearer admin token (default 4-hour expiry); Adobe Commerce as a Cloud Service authenticates via Adobe IMS (OAuth 2)
Change detection
Polling with searchCriteria filters on updated_at (catalog, sales, and customer entities carry created_at/updated_at); optional near-real-time via the Adobe Commerce Webhooks / Adobe I/O Events modules (order/created, product/updated, customer/created)
Capabilities
read · write · webhooks
Rate limits
No fixed request-per-minute cap on PaaS/on-prem; responses page via searchCriteria pageSize/currentPage under a default maximum page size of 300 (Web API Input Limits), with /async/bulk endpoints for large writes.
